1 /*      $NetBSD: h_reconcli.c,v 1.2 2011/02/19 09:56:45 pooka Exp $     */
2
3 #include <sys/types.h>
4 #include <sys/sysctl.h>
5
6 #include <rump/rumpclient.h>
7 #include <rump/rump_syscalls.h>
8
9 #include <err.h>
10 #include <pthread.h>
11 #include <stdio.h>
12 #include <stdlib.h>
13 #include <string.h>
14 #include <unistd.h>
15
16 static volatile int quit, riseandwhine;
17
18 static pthread_mutex_t closermtx;
19 static pthread_cond_t closercv;
20
21 static void *
22 closer(void *arg)
23 {
24
25         pthread_mutex_lock(&closermtx);
26         while (!quit) {
27                 while (!riseandwhine)
28                         pthread_cond_wait(&closercv, &closermtx);
29                 riseandwhine = 0;
30                 pthread_mutex_unlock(&closermtx);
31
32                 /* try to catch a random slot */
33                 usleep(random() % 100000);
34
35                 /*
36                  * wide-angle disintegration beam, but takes care
37                  * of the client rumpkernel communication socket.
38                  */
39                 closefrom(3);
40
41                 pthread_mutex_lock(&closermtx);
42         }
43         pthread_mutex_unlock(&closermtx);
44
45         return NULL;
46 }
47
48 static const int hostnamemib[] = { CTL_KERN, KERN_HOSTNAME };
49 static char goodhostname[128];
50
51 static void *
52 worker(void *arg)
53 {
54         char hostnamebuf[128];
55         size_t blen;
56
57         pthread_mutex_lock(&closermtx);
58         while (!quit) {
59                 pthread_mutex_unlock(&closermtx);
60                 if (rump_sys_getpid() == -1)
61                         err(1, "getpid");
62
63                 blen = sizeof(hostnamebuf);
64                 memset(hostnamebuf, 0, sizeof(hostnamebuf));
65                 if (rump_sys___sysctl(hostnamemib, __arraycount(hostnamemib),
66                     hostnamebuf, &blen, NULL, 0) == -1)
67                         err(1, "sysctl");
68                 if (strcmp(hostnamebuf, goodhostname) != 0)
69                         exit(1);
70                 pthread_mutex_lock(&closermtx);
71                 riseandwhine = 1;
72                 pthread_cond_signal(&closercv);
73         }
74         riseandwhine = 1;
75         pthread_cond_signal(&closercv);
76         pthread_mutex_unlock(&closermtx);
77
78         return NULL;
79 }
80
81 int
82 main(int argc, char *argv[])
83 {
84         pthread_t pt, w1, w2, w3, w4;
85         size_t blen;
86         int timecount;
87
88         if (argc != 2)
89                 errx(1, "need timecount");
90         timecount = atoi(argv[1]);
91         if (timecount <= 0)
92                 errx(1, "invalid timecount %d\n", timecount);
93
94         srandom(time(NULL));
95
96         rumpclient_setconnretry(RUMPCLIENT_RETRYCONN_INFTIME);
97         if (rumpclient_init() == -1)
98                 err(1, "init");
99
100         blen = sizeof(goodhostname);
101         if (rump_sys___sysctl(hostnamemib, __arraycount(hostnamemib),
102             goodhostname, &blen, NULL, 0) == -1)
103                 err(1, "sysctl");
104
105         pthread_create(&pt, NULL, closer, NULL);
106         pthread_create(&w1, NULL, worker, NULL);
107         pthread_create(&w2, NULL, worker, NULL);
108         pthread_create(&w3, NULL, worker, NULL);
109         pthread_create(&w4, NULL, worker, NULL);
110
111         sleep(timecount);
112         quit = 1;
113
114         pthread_join(pt, NULL);
115         pthread_join(w1, NULL);
116         pthread_join(w2, NULL);
117         pthread_join(w3, NULL);
118         pthread_join(w4, NULL);
119
120         exit(0);
121 }
